What does /o/ think of Crown Vics?
Driving a mazda 6 v6 I want something with a v8 engine, and rear wheel drive, my sister keeps trying to talk me out of it, but I can get an 2011 crown vic, with around 160k kms for 2k.
I also looked at accord coupe but the one i went to see was an 03 model and those had some nasty transmission problems
god damn nigger we have this thread like once a week if not more
it's a big fucking barge with a lazy but torquey engine that will run basically forever
it doesn't have angry headlights, it doesn't connect to your phone, it doesn't have electronic stability control, you're lucky if it even has traction control and ABS, it likes kicking the ass end out on loose surfaces, it has the slowest shifting auto transmission known to mankind, it exists in a perpetual state of 15 degree body roll, everyone will think you're a cop and if you put a bull bar and lights on it we'll make fun of you and your autism
it has fantastic visibility, it's comfortable to drive, you can fit four full size spare tires in the trunk (track day NO) and still have room for a jack and groceries, gas mileage isn't as bad as you'd think, the 4.6 SOHC is reliable as fuck once they worked out the intake manifold kinks in '03 and easy as hell to work on with loads of room in the engine bay, it's the last car to have body on frame construction so if you live in the salty north body rust won't compromise the structural integrity of the car (and they can all be replaced), carry your shit, carry your family, carry their shit, still go up hills at half throttle like nothing
it's the last remnant of the classical American family sedan, a big car that is very, very good at being a big car and not very good at things that don't involve being a car
also consider: mercury grand marquis (crown vic with a different badge) and lincoln town car (crown vic with LUXURYâ„¢ options)
